    Riding Enduro6 solo and was wondering if anybody out there knows if there is a correct amount to drink per hour while racing?

    MrCrushrider
    Free Member

    about 1ltr per hour i think? maybe a bit more/less depending on temperature

    Rickos
    Free Member

    Yeah, I've always thought about 1 litre per hour, but OK to be less if it's cold but more if hot. Need to take into account electrolytes over a long time period though.
